YARN & CANDY CANE ORNAMENTS

You’ll Need:
- 2″ styrofoam balls
- yarn in your favorite colors
- mini candy canes
- hot glue gun

Directions:
1. Insert 5 mini candy canes in a circle around the ball. Try to space them out somewhat evenly, but it doesn’t need to be perfect!

2. One at a time, remove each candy cane from it’s styrofoam hole, add a little hot glue to the hole, then stick the candy cane back in… this will ensure that the candy canes stay put.

3. Start wrapping yarn randomly around the ball, weaving in between the candy canes until the entire ball is covered. Trim the yarn and secure the end with a small dab of hot glue.

That’s it! Add a ribbon loop if you want to use these as hanging ornaments. You can also try this idea with regular sized candy canes and 4″ styrofoam balls to create GIANT ornaments!
